NEW YORK, Feb. 16, 2023 /PRNewswire/ -- The WNET Group is raising awareness of New York State's opioid addiction and overdose crisis with special programming and community engagement efforts in February, with the aim to draw attention to this public health crisis and community services available for those impacted by addiction.

  • The WNET Group developed this effort in a collaboration with the New York State Office of Addiction Services and Support (OASAS), relying on their scientific and treatment expertise.
  • The New York State Office of Addiction Services and Support (OASAS) oversees one of the nation's largest addiction services systems with approximately 1,600 prevention, treatment and recovery programs.
